  • Abstract
    The real-world process of generating a large spatio-temporal data collection presents a very difficult technical problem. First, this process is very expensive, requiring a lot of various high-technology software tools and modern hardware infrastructure (sensors, servers, GPS infrastructure etc.) installations; second, the recorded trajectories sometimes cannot represent any special traffic or movement patterns. The simulation framework introduced in this paper can generate diverse trajectory datasets based on predetermined movement patterns.
